The Plough Inn
The Plough Inn is steeped in history dating back to 1786. Wreay is a stunning picturesque village, 5 miles south of Carlisle. The Plough has achieved an excellent reputation for its food and real ale, winning Carlisle Living’s Best Country Pub Award 2017 and nominated for Best Country Pub 2014/2015/2016. Winning CAMRA Winter pub of the season 2016. Trip Advisor Certificate of Excellence Awards both 2015 and 2017. Food is cooked fresh to order and locally sourced always. Meals are served Wednesday– Sunday lunch and evening. Monday evenings we hold a charity fun quiz in which monies are given to local charities in which to date over £12,000 has been raised.
